Buyer demand for New Zealand businesses has climbed, says business broker Link, which is reporting record engagement and stronger deal completion across the board.Link national business development manager Steve Matthews said it recorded a 19% year-on-year rise in signed confidentiality agreements, a key indicator of buyer interest, alongside a 32% increase in engagement per listing.“This is a clear signal of growing intent among buyers, even in sectors where economic conditions have traditionally made sales harder to achieve,”...
